One good thing about the Lakers playoffs: Reservations are damn easy to come by at restaurants around town. According to Open Table, tonight at the height of game six, there are at least 85 restaurants that have tables avail between 7:30pm and 8:30pm. (Only Craft's listing says nothing outside of 6:30pm and 9:30pm). At the Mozzas: the Pizzeria has a two top open at 9:30pm, but the Osteria is wide open (8:15pm, 8:30:pm, 8:45). Sometimes stracciatella with celery and herb salad trumps Kobe. Sorry. [~ELA~]
